If the car hasn't been driven for 3 years, I'd do all the maintenance first, then mods. How many miles on her? I'd check/replace the following;
All drive/accessory belts
Tires
rear subframe bushings & check subframe
coolant flush & brake flush
Oil/filter
Then consider joining your local BMW Car Club of America (CCA) Chapter, and sign up for a car control clinic. You could also do some auto cross after with the CCA which would help you learn the car in a safe controlled environment. If I had a 1 of 2 car like that, I'd be tempted to keep it reasonably stock (boring, I know ). The 3.0 Coupe is already a sub-6 second car to 60, so its already got plenty of poke. If I was to do any mods, I'd consider double adjustable TC Klines, or Koni FSD's (depending on how you intend to use the car).
In summary I'd spend my money on maintenance, driver's ed'/training then modifications. Have fun with her!
